About Wild Sound

This is the first study of U.S. composer Maryanne Amacher (1938-2009), an elusive and original figure in music composition, sound art, installation, and media aesthetics. Wild Sound animates her creative and speculative approaches to how sound can be heard: as a fictional narrative, as a long distance connection, as a music composed of tones that originate inside the listener's inner ear.
